In this episode, we break down the heated debate that’s been raging in the biker world forever: Is it a Motorcycle Club (MC) or a Motorcycle Gang? We start with the latest outlaw biker news out of the Pittsburgh area involving two young Pagans Motorcycle Club members accused of assaulting a 70-year-old man, ripping off his shirt, and landing in serious legal trouble.

According to reports, Robert Browne (27) and Devin Colucci (25) from Lower Burrell allegedly confronted the victim at Mohegan’s Irish Pub (also referred to as Mohei’s) in Westmoreland County after seeing what they believed was an “Outlaw OMG” shirt. The incident escalated into robbery, simple assault, theft, disorderly conduct, criminal mischief, harassment, and more — with one facing an additional weapons charge. Both are being held on $300,000 bail.

In this breaking biker news breakdown, we dive deep into the latest developments in the Pagans Outlaw Motorcycle Club vs. Unknown Bikers confrontation at the West Norriton Wawa on October 17, 2025. A Montgomery County judge just denied severance requests, forcing six Pagans members into a joint trial on charges including aggravated assault, simple assault, recklessly endangering other persons, and riot.

The court ruled that the defendants “will not be prejudiced” by being tried together — but is that total horse crap? When one co-defendant already pleaded guilty and admitted acting as support, and evidence against others could easily spill over, how can these guys get a fair shake? Juries are famous for getting it wrong, especially when outlaw motorcycle clubs like the Pagans MC are involved and the case hits the headlines.

We also cover the positive side: Charges were fully dismissed against two Pagans members (Erik Dixon and Luke Higgins) due to lack of evidence tying them directly to any assault. Their attorneys argued they never engaged, stayed on their bikes, and left after gunfire broke out — and the judge got it right this time.

Plus, details on Jason William Lawless‘ guilty plea to misdemeanor simple assault and conspiracy. He received time served (credit for 145 days) plus probation after admitting he didn’t physically fight but was present to provide support.

This case highlights a bigger issue: Are biker club members getting slammed with bad rulings and prejudicial joint trials just because of their colors and the “big news” factor? Defense lawyers warned about spillover evidence ruining individual assessments — common sense that seems ignored here.

Snitches end up in ditches — literally. In this case, it was a canal in the Chicago area. We dive deep into the brutal 2020 murder of Carl Gordon, a prospective member of the Dem Bastards Motorcycle Club. Accused of being a snitch and overstepping as a prospect, Gordon was executed in the basement of the Joliet chapter clubhouse on Ruby Street, wrapped in plastic, duct-taped, weighed down, and dumped in the Cal-Sag Canal where his body was later found floating.

This story exposes the harsh reality inside the biker world: Everybody talks tough about “we knew what we signed up for” and “snitches get stitches,” but when the heat is on, too many still flip and run their mouth — or in this case, allegedly get taken out for it. From the club president pulling the trigger to the involvement of the VP and enforcer, this case shows how fast things can go from a prospect meeting to a first-degree murder charge.

Pagans MC Member Jason Lawless Takes Plea Deal in Wawa Shooting – Admits Pagans Are a Criminal Organization & Dooms Co-Defendants?

In this explosive breakdown of the latest development in the West Norriton Wawa biker gang shooting, we dive deep into how one Pagans Outlaw Motorcycle Club member’s guilty plea could destroy the chances for the other eight charged Pagans. Jason William Lawless, 46, became the first of nine Pagans members to plead guilty to simple assault and conspiracy after the chaotic October 17, 2025 confrontation with rival Unknown Bikers at the Wawa parking lot in West Norriton, Pennsylvania.

The plea includes a damaging summation read in court where Lawless allegedly admitted the Pagans are a 1%er outlaw motorcycle gang, that members have an “understanding” to use violence when encountering rivals in their territory, and that the group acted together with intent to assault. This admission of conspiracy and coordinated violence just made life a thousand times harder for the remaining defendants heading to trial.

The Satan’s Choice MC is back and exploding across the globe in 2025-2026! The revived Satan’s Choice Motorcycle Club, led by Harley Davidson Guindon (son of legendary founder Bernie “The Frog” Guindon), is making massive moves with new chapters popping up everywhere—from Sudbury, Ontario to the United States, and now even Finland (Helsinki chapter) and beyond. This outlaw motorcycle club (1%er MC) is spreading like wildfire, building brotherhood, community involvement, and a new generation of riders hungry for real biker life.

In this video, we dive deep into the latest news: the Sudbury chapter of Satan’s Choice MC stepping up big time by serving food and spreading warmth at the Energy Court encampment—real community giveback from a club with deep Canadian roots. We cover the club’s wild history (including 90s drama like the Sudbury police station bombing tied to a strip club beef), but focus on how times have changed. The club was defunct after the 2000 patch-over to Hells Angels, briefly revived in 2017, and now fully relaunched in 2025 with Harley’s vision—expanding to the USA (Arizona, NYC, Chicago, Detroit, and more), Canada-wide chapters, and international spots like Finland’s Northern European chapter.
